About 2-[5-[(3S)-6-cyclohexyl-1-(hydroxyamino)-1-oxohexan-3-yl]-1,2,4-oxadiazol-3-yl]-N,N-dimethylpyridine-4-carboxamide

2-[5-[(3S)-6-cyclohexyl-1-(hydroxyamino)-1-oxohexan-3-yl]-1,2,4-oxadiazol-3-yl]-N,N-dimethylpyridine-4-carboxamide (PubChem CID 135754561) has the molecular formula C22H31N5O4 and a molecular weight of 429.52 g/mol. Its IUPAC name is 2-[5-[(3S)-6-cyclohexyl-1-(hydroxyamino)-1-oxohexan-3-yl]-1,2,4-oxadiazol-3-yl]-N,N-dimethylpyridine-4-carboxamide.
